Groundjay to Invest US$60 Mln in Display Production in Guangxi, China
April 15, 2011

Taiwanese display manufacturer Groundjay announced that the company has signed a cooperation agreement with Beihai Municipal Government of Guangxi Province, China on April 9, 2011 for display production, according to the Commercial Times of Taiwan. The agreement is valued at US$60 million. It is reported that the new plant will focus on LCD (Liquid Crystal Display) display, LCD TV, and component R&D, production, sales, and maintenance services. Production is slated for September this year. The Beihai plant is projected to manufacture more than 1.5 million displays in the first year, and it aims to churn out over five million units in three years.
